37-inch OLED TVs from Matsushita

Matsushita has plans to mass produce 37″ OLED TVs within the next three years, and that is an interesting development since it could prove the spark to jump-start the OLED market which is priced out of reach of ordinary folk at that point in day. Matsushita is targeting a neighborhood price of $1,400 for the entry level 37″ model, which bodes well since OLED

is by far more superior compared to LCD technology that rules the roost at that point in day. whether you haven’t yet upgraded to the world of HDTV, when will you take the plunge?
